New drug ONO-7428 enters first human tests for Hard-to-Treat cancers
NCT ID NCT06816108
First seen Nov 19, 2025 · Last updated May 08, 2026 · Updated 20 times
Summary
This early-phase study tests a new drug called ONO-7428 in about 60 adults with advanced solid tumors (including some lung cancers) that have not responded to standard treatments. The main goal is to see if the drug is safe and tolerable, and to find the right dose. Participants will receive the drug and be monitored for side effects and any tumor shrinkage.
